No Promotional Use. 4.3 The Licensee shall not include any Work or part thereof in a promotional or sponsorship message for the Licensee, the producer of the Programme, any broadcaster of the Programme or any third party unless expressly permitted in the Term Sheet.
No Promotional Use. The Licensee shall not use the Work or part of the Work in such a way as to imply approval or endorsement of the Licensee or any third party, or in any promotional message, save in relation to the copying or issuing of copies to the public in the UK for the purpose of advertising the sale of the relevant Work.

No Promotional Use. Licensee shall not itself, nor shall Licensee permit any third parties to, make use of the Licensed Property or Licensed Products for any promotional purposes (including, without limitation, premium offers, giveaways, sales incentives, charitable giving, donations, gift-with-purchase programs), without Licensor’s Approval in each instance.
No Promotional Use the Licensee will not, and will procure that its Guests do not, commercialise the Hospitality Area in any way including, without limitation, through any ticket “giveaway”, without prior written consent from SACA.

  • Commercial Use the use of the Licensed Material for the purpose of monetary reward (whether by or for the Institution or an Authorised User) by means of sale, resale, loan, transfer, hire or other form of exploitation of the Licensed Material. For the avoidance of doubt, the use by the Institution or Authorised Users of the Licensed Material in the course of research funded by a commercial organisation is not deemed to constitute Commercial Use. Recovery of costs is not being deemed Commercial Use. The use of Metadata by search engines does not constitute Commercial Use as long as that Metadata is not sold, lent, distributed or otherwise re-licensed via that search engine or the access to that Metadata on that search engine is exclusively being charged for.

  • SINGLE-USE PRODUCTS The Board of County Commissioners has established a single-use products and plastic bags policy intended to reduce the use of products which have become globally recognized as having lasting negative impacts on the environment. Neither single-use products nor plastic bags may be sold or disbursed on County property by staff or contracted vendors, except as set forth in Orange County Administrative Regulation 9.01.03. Failure to comply with the Regulation may result in termination of the contract or other contractual remedies, and may affect future contracting with the County. The use of reusable, recyclable, biodegradable, or compostable materials is encouraged.
